User's Manual
248
µPD750008 USER'S MANUAL
In
Mne-
Number
Machine
Address-
struc-
monic
Operand of
cycle
Operation ing Skip condition
tion bytes area
SET1 mem.bit 2 2 (mem.bit) <– 1
*
3
fmem.bit 2 2 (fmem.bit) <– 1
*
4
pmem.@L 2 2 (pmem
7-2
+L
3-2
.bit(L
1-0
)) <– 1
*
5
@H+mem.bit 2 2 (H+mem
3-0
.bit) <– 1
*
1
CLR1 mem.bit 2 2 (mem.bit) <– 0
*
3
fmem.bit 2 2 (fmem.bit) <– 0
*
4
pmem.@L 2 2 (pmem
7-2
+L
3-2
.bit(L
1-0
)) <– 0
*
5
@H+mem.bit 2 2 (H+mem
3-0
.bit) <– 0
*
1
SKT mem.bit 2 2+S Skip if (mem.bit)=1
*
3 (mem.bit)=1
fmem.bit 2 2+S Skip if (fmem.bit)=1
*
4 (fmem.bit)=1
pmem.@L 2 2+S
Skip if (pmem
7-2
+L
3-2
.bit(L
1-0
))=1
*
5 (pmem.@L)=1
@H+mem.bit 2 2+S Skip if (H+mem
3-0
.bit)=1
*
1 (@H+mem.bit)=1
SKF mem.bit 2 2+S Skip if (mem.bit)=0
*
3 (mem.bit)=0
fmem.bit 2 2+S Skip if (fmem.bit)=0
*
4 (fmem.bit)=0
pmem.@L 2 2+S
Skip if (pmem
7-2
+L
3-2
.bit(L
1-0
))=0
*
5 (pmem.@L)=0
@H+mem.bit 2 2+S Skip if (H+mem
3-0
.bit)=0
*
1 (@H+mem.bit)=0
SKTCLR
fmem.bit 2 2+S Skip if (fmem.bit)=1 and clear
*
4 (fmem.bit)=1
pmem.@L 2 2+S Skip if (pmem
7-2
+L
3-2
.bit(L
1-0
))
*
5 (pmem.@L)=1
=1 and clear
@H+mem.bit 2 2+S Skip if (H+mem
3-0
.bit)=1
*
1 (@H+mem.bit)=1
and clear
AND1 CY,fmem.bit 2 2 CY <– CY (fmem.bit)
*
4
CY,pmem.@L 2 2 CY <– CY
*
5
(pmem
7-2
+L
3-2
.bit(L
1-0
))
CY,@H+mem.bit
2 2 CY <– CY Y (H+mem
3-0
.bit)
*
1
OR1 CY,fmem.bit 2 2 CY <– CY (fmem.bit)
*
4
CY,pmem.@L 2 2 CY <– CY
*
5
(pmem
7-2
+L
3-2
.bit(L
1-0
))
CY,@H+mem.bit
2 2 CY <– CY (H+mem
3-0
.bit)
*
1
XOR1 CY,fmem.bit 2 2 CY <– CY (fmem.bit)
*
4
CY,pmem.@L 2 2 CY <– CY
*
5
(pmem
7-2
+L
3-2
.bit(L
1-0
))
CY,@H+mem.bit
2 2 CY <– CY (H+mem
3-0
.bit)
*
1
Memory bit manipulation